Tips for Taking High-Quality Photos

Now that we understand the importance of high-quality photos in commercial real estate listings, let's look at some tips for capturing visually appealing images:

1. Hire a Professional Photographer

  • A professional photographer has the skills and equipment to capture the best angles and lighting for your property.
  • Investing in professional photography can make a significant difference in the quality of your listing photos.

2. Focus on Lighting

  • Good lighting is crucial for capturing clear, vibrant photos of your property.
  • Avoid harsh shadows and aim to shoot during the day when natural light is abundant.

3. Stage the Property

  • Remove clutter and stage the property to showcase its potential.
  • Consider adding some decorative elements to make the space more inviting and appealing.

4. Capture Different Angles

  • Take photos from multiple angles to give potential buyers a comprehensive view of the property.
  • Include shots of key features such as the exterior, interior, and any amenities.
